Liz Evans

Liz Evans is the Program Director for Civic Education and Outreach at Arizona State University’s Center for American Civics, where she leads statewide and national initiatives to strengthen civic learning. She brings more than 2 decades of experience in civic education as a former public school educator and current leader in the field.


Liz serves in national leadership for Educating for American Democracy, helping guide strategy, partnerships, and implementation to advance excellence in history and civics education. She is also the host of the Civics in a Year podcast, which supports educators in deepening their content knowledge and instructional practice.


She is a National Board Certified Teacher and a Project Management Professional, with advanced degrees in education from Northern Arizona University, including a doctorate in educational leadership
